Matías Ezequiel Rudler (born 25 April 1988) is an Argentine footballer who plays as a defender for Atlètic Escaldes.
Rudler started his career with Argentine third division side All Boys where he made 17 league appearances and scored 1 goal [1] and helped them achieve promotion to the Argentine top flight within 3 seasons.
In 2014, Rudler signed for Independiente de Chivilcoy in the Argentine fourth division [2] after playing for Argentine top flight club San Martín de San Juan, [3] before joining San Lorenzo de Alem in the Argentine third division.
In 2019, he signed for Andorran team Engordany. [4]
